    Win N100,000 cash every day for 30 days at Konga Naija Shopping Festival

    mmBy ITPulseDecember 6, 2023
    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Pinterest LinkedIn Reddit Tumblr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Three lucky customers are expected to win up to N100,000 every day from the 1st to the 31st of December on KongaTV.com in the Konga Naija Shopping Festival, the eCommerce Xmas Sales promo for the year.

     

    Announcing this in a statement, the Vice President of Marketing at Konga Group, Rita Ohaedoghasi, stated that to participate, shoppers are to visit KongaTV.com at 11 am every morning all through the month, subscribe to its YouTube channel and answer a question correctly. Winners will be announced at 6 pm daily. 

     

    The statement added that there will be price slashes on products during the festival.

    Konga Group recently launched what customers describe as Africa’s pioneer shopping network, a 24-hour Television network where deals and discounts between manufacturers, distributors of genuine products and shoppers happen daily. 

     

    Aptly described by Dr Dapo Ojerinde a USA-based digital enthusiast, KongaTV is “a huge platform that brings both sellers and buyers face to face to transact with peace of mind because Konga guarantees the genuineness of products and transactions. Manufacturers, distributors and young SMEs now have a cheaper network to showcase their products straight to consumers and African governments can use this platform for true commodities trading.”

     

    Konga was acquired by Zinox Group from Naspers in a mega deal in 2018, the new owners, according to facts available, have injected millions of dollars and experience to position it as the leading composite eCommerce group in Africa with many verticals.
